Historical information
St Kilda was declared a city on 2/12/1890. In commemoration of the centenary, a conservatory in the St Kilda Botanical Gardens was opened on 2/12/1990 by the Mayor, Cr. Melanie Eagle, at a Garden Festival.
Four years later, in 1994, the City of St Kilda was amalgamated with the cities of South Melbourne and Port Melbourne to form the City of Port Phillip.
Physical description
Laminated poster mounted on board depicting images of dancers, the St Kilda Botanical Gardens and the St Kilda crest and logo
Inscriptions & markings
City of St Kilda Centenary Festival St Kilda Botanical Gardens and St Kilda Town Hall December 2 1990
